WebAdipose tissue has in recent years been recognized as a major endocrine organ, as it produces hormones such as: Leptin, which targets the hypothalamus and is important in regulating food intake. Estrogen, which plays a key role in sexual function. Resistin, which targets several tissues with unknown function. Specialized glands that make up your endocrine system make and release most of the hormones in your body. A gland is an organ that makes one or more substances, such as hormones, digestive juices, sweat or tears. Endocrine glands release hormones directly into your bloodstream. The hypothalamus is an integral part of the brain. It is a small cone-shaped structure that projects downward from the brain, ending in the pituitary (infundibular) stalk, a tubular connection to the pituitary gland.
